What does Oryzon Genomics do? The company Oryzon Genomics SA is a biopharmaceutical company that was founded in 2000 in Barcelona, Spain. Since then, the company has gained a growing reputation for the development of innovative therapeutic approaches for serious diseases. Oryzon works on the development of epigenetic products that focus on molecular docking sites in the cell to modulate approved proteins and fragments. They use a unique technology called ORY-1001 to promote tumor apoptosis. The technology involves the use of epigenetic modulators to develop therapeutic approaches for certain types of cancer such as CLL and leukemia. Oryzon operates various divisions such as Research and Development, Intellectual Property, and Product Development. Within Research and Development, they work on the research and development of new technologies and products. They also have a portfolio of patented and potential patent applications in the field of epigenetics and products for the treatment of various types of cancer, neurodegenerative diseases such as Alzheimer's, and schizophrenia. The Intellectual Property division is responsible for all of Oryzon's patent rights. They review all of Oryzon's patents to ensure they meet the highest standards of patent law. The Product Development department helps the company in transferring newly developed products into effective and approved drugs. They also assist in the approval process by health authorities, particularly in the field of clinical trials. FCF Yield measures the free cash flow per share relative to the stock price. It indicates how much cash a company generates for each dollar invested.
